Arson Explosive Team Look Into Briefcase Left At Stevenson Ranch Bank

A briefcase left behind at a Wells Fargo in Stevenson Ranch prompted the Arson/Explosives Detail to investigate as a security precaution, according to Sheriff’s Station officials.

A briefcase was reported around 11:45 a.m. on the 22600 block of Stevenson Ranch at the Wells Fargo, station officials said.

As a precaution, deputies with the Santa Clarita Valley Sheriff’s Station evacuated the building shortly after, while awaiting the arrival of the bomb squad.

The Arson Explosives Detail is based in Whittier, however, there are deputies with that detail who live in the area.

Deputies were scheduled to arrive at 1 p.m. to investigate the finding, which is also near the local field office for Congressman Howard “Buck” McKeon.

That office was also evacuated, with people expected to be kept out until the briefcase has been cleared.
